Cargo Theft Losses Double in Q2 2026: What Shippers Need to Know About Seal Strategy

Cargo Theft Losses Double in Q2 2026: What Shippers Need to Know About Seal Strategy

A freight forwarder in Charleston received a letter from their largest customer in July 2026. The customer, a Fortune 500 electronics importer, had just survived a C-TPAT audit — but barely. The auditor flagged the company’s seal program: their forwarder was using a generic bolt seal with no ISO 17712 certification on file, no serialized barcode, and no manufacturer test certificate. The audit finding meant the importer had 30 days to produce documentation or lose their C-TPAT benefits.

The forwarder called their seal supplier. The supplier had no test certificates. The seals had been sold as “high security” based on appearance alone — steel construction, a pin-and-barrel design, a bolt head that looked the part. But nobody had ever verified the ISO 17712 classification.

This scenario plays out more often than the industry admits. And in Q2 2026, the stakes got higher.

Cargo Theft Value Doubled Year Over Year

Verisk CargoNet’s Q2 2026 data showed theft value climbing sharply compared with the same period in 2025. Overhaul, the transportation security technology firm, rated cargo theft as a high risk for the second half of 2026. The trend is clear: thieves are attempting fewer, higher-value hits. When the target is a pallet of medicine, a crate of premium food, or a batch of branded electronics, the loss is not just the unit price — it is spoilage, counterfeiting, and the erosion of trust.

The Guinness trailer theft in Runcorn, UK, underscored this shift. A stolen trailer carrying valuable cargo does not just mean equipment replacement costs. It means lost product, disrupted customer deliveries, insurance claims, reputational damage, and recovery expenses. For logistics operators, the message is unambiguous: cargo security must extend beyond the cab and into every asset carrying goods through the supply chain.

Deceptive Pickup Schemes Rose 31%

One of the most disturbing trends in 2026 is the rise of carrier impersonation. FreightWaves reported that deceptive pickup schemes involving false identities, forged credentials, and carrier impersonation rose 31% year over year in Q1 2026. In one case, a driver allegedly impersonating an assigned carrier diverted a $586,000 copper shipment from its intended destination to a Kentucky warehouse. Investigators recovered all six pallets in roughly eight hours — but only because connected shipment data and decisive coordination compressed the recovery window.

The operational lesson is not simply “install tracking.” Several controls had to work in sequence: someone recognized a deviation, the right parties shared usable identifiers, law enforcement received actionable location data, and the cargo remained identifiable when officers arrived. Physical security — including proper seal application and verification — remains the first line of defense.

What This Means for Your Seal Program

If your organization moves cargo internationally, your seal program is no longer a procurement afterthought. It is a compliance and risk management requirement. Here is what shippers need to verify in Q3 2026:

ISO 17712 Certification Documentation

The single most important criterion. Request a manufacturer’s test certificate showing the seal has passed ISO 17712:2013 Category H testing — tensile strength, shear resistance, bend testing, and impact testing. A supplier that cannot produce this certificate is not selling a certified product. The certificate should reference the specific seal model, the testing laboratory, and the date of testing.

Ocean carrier ONE (Ocean Network Express) issued a global mandate on July 2, 2026, requiring ISO 17712 High Security seals on every container in its fleet. U.S. CBP’s C-TPAT program requires high-security seals on all ISO containers moving through supply chains of certified importers. The European AEO program is tightening its Trust & Check framework toward mandatory electronic sealing by 2034.

Serialization and Barcode

Every bolt seal, cable seal, and container lock seal must carry a unique serial number, typically laser-etched onto both components. The number should never be duplicated within a batch. Many seals now include a barcode alongside the serial number, enabling scan-based verification at gate-in, transit checkpoints, and delivery. If your operation uses a TMS or WMS with barcode scanning, confirm the barcode symbology is compatible with your existing scanners.

Anti-Spin Locking Mechanism

A quality bolt seal includes an anti-spin feature: once the pin is inserted into the barrel, the seal rotates as a single unit. This prevents an attacker from gripping the bolt head with pliers and rotating the pin out of the barrel. Low-quality seals without anti-spin can sometimes be defeated by rotating the pin with sufficient force, even without cutting tools.

Multi-Layered Security Approach

Technology is not a replacement for physical security, driver procedures, secure parking, and effective site controls. The growing complexity of cargo crime points toward a multi-layered approach in which physical security is supported by tracking, video, driver identification, and real-time alerts. Research published by Geotab in 2026 found that real-time GPS location, driver identity verification, and asset-level tracking are among the capabilities that can make a difference when a theft occurs.

For high-value loads, create geofences around the origin, approved route, planned fuel stops, and consignee. Alert on unexpected stops, route deviations, tracker silence, trailer separation, or arrival at an unapproved warehouse. A destination mismatch should be treated as a security event, not a routine service exception.

Seal Types for Different Risk Levels

Not all cargo faces the same threat profile. A domestic pallet of consumer goods has different requirements than an international container of pharmaceuticals.

Risk LevelTypical CargoRecommended SealKey Feature
HighInternational containers, electronics, pharmaBolt Seal (ISO 17712-H)Anti-spin, laser serialization, test certificate
MediumRailcars, domestic trucking, warehouse doorsCable SealAdjustable length, tamper-evident wire
StandardUtility meters, retail inventory, food servicePlastic SealColor-coded, sequential numbering, cost-effective
SpecializedHigh-value single items, cash boxesPadlock SealReusable with unique key, visible deterrent
TrackingTemperature-sensitive, high-valueRFID SealPassive UHF scanning, digital chain of custody
BulkDrums, rail hatches, mailbagsMetal Strap SealFixed length, stainless steel option
EnhancedSmart containers, AEO complianceContainer Lock SealIntegrated locking, compatible with electronic systems

The VVTT Protocol: Verify Before Release

Before releasing any sealed container, logistics staff should execute the VVTT protocol:

  • View: View the seal and container locking mechanisms for visible damage or substitution.
  • Verify: Verify the seal number against shipping documentation and the manufacturer’s records.
  • Tug: Tug on the seal hard to ensure it is properly locked and seated.
  • Twist: Twist the seal to confirm it does not disengage or spin freely.

The 7-point structural inspection — checking front wall, left side, right side, floor, ceiling, doors, and undercarriage — remains mandatory for C-TPAT compliance. But the seal itself is only as good as the verification process around it.

FAQ

What is ISO 17712:2013 Category H?

Category H (High Security) is the highest classification under ISO 17712:2013, requiring a minimum tensile strength of 2,268 kg (5,000 lbs). Only Category H seals are acceptable for international container shipping under C-TPAT and AEO programs.

How do I verify my seal supplier’s ISO 17712 certification?

Request a manufacturer test certificate that references the specific seal model, testing laboratory, and date of testing. Cross-check the laboratory’s accreditation. If the supplier cannot produce this documentation, the seal is not certified.

What is the difference between a bolt seal and a cable seal?

A bolt seal is a two-piece mechanical seal with a steel pin and barrel, designed for ISO containers and high-security applications. A cable seal uses a steel wire loop and adjustable locking body, offering flexibility in length but generally lower tensile strength than a certified bolt seal.

Can RFID seals replace traditional mechanical seals?

RFID seals complement rather than replace mechanical seals. A passive UHF RFID seal provides digital verification and chain-of-custody tracking, but the physical tamper-evidence still depends on the mechanical design. Many shippers use RFID-enabled bolt seals for the best of both worlds.

What should I do if a seal number does not match documentation?

Treat it as a security event. Do not accept the container. Document the discrepancy with photographs, notify your security team and the carrier, and initiate an incident report. A mismatched seal number is one of the earliest indicators of tampering or substitution.
